Diagnostic and Troubleshooting Steps

Is your Hotpoint washer not spinning? This step-by-step guide covers everything from drive belts to control boards, and offering practical solutions.

Diagnostic & Troubleshooting
Check for an Imbalanced Load

Step 1:

Check for an Imbalanced Load

  • Stop the washer and redistribute the clothes inside the drum.
  • Remove excess items if the drum is overloaded.
  • Restart the cycle to see if the washer spins properly.
Inspect the Lid Switch

Step 2:

Inspect the Lid Switch

  • Ensure the washer lid is closing securely.
  • Listen for a clicking sound when you close the lid. If you don’t hear a click, the lid switch may need replacement.
Examine the Drain System

Step 3:

Examine the Drain System

  • Check the drain hose for kinks, blockages, or clogs.
  • Inspect the drain pump for debris that may be preventing water from draining.
  • Clear any clogs and try running the washer again.
Inspect the Drive Belt

Step 4:

Inspect the Drive Belt

  • Unplug the washer and access the drive belt by removing the back panel.
  • Check the belt for signs of wear, fraying, or breakage. If it’s damaged, replace it.
Test the Motor Coupling

Step 5:

Test the Motor Coupling

  • Disconnect the washer from the power source and access the motor coupling.
  • Inspect the coupling for cracks or damage. Replace it if necessary.
Check the Clutch Assembly

Step 6:

Check the Clutch Assembly

  • If the washer drum spins but struggles to reach the proper speed, the clutch may be worn out.
  • Replacing the clutch requires disassembling parts of the washer, so professional assistance may be needed.
Test the Timer and Control Board

Step 7:

Test the Timer and Control Board

  • Inspect the timer and control board for visible damage, such as burned-out circuits or loose connections.
  • If these components aren’t functioning, they may need repair or replacement.

Key Actions for Homeowners:

  • Avoid overloading the washer.
  • Clean the drain system regularly.
  • Check for loose items to avoid damage to internal components.
  • Perform routine inspections of the drive belt, motor coupling, and other components for signs of wear or damage.
  • Use a washer cleaning solution or vinegar to clean the drum and prevent residue buildup.

Most Common Repairs Needed to Fix Hotpoint Washers

When your washer is not spinning, certain repairs are more commonly required than others. Below are the most frequent fixes:

    • Replace a Broken Drive Belt: The drive belt powers the drum’s rotation. A worn or snapped belt needs replacement to restore spinning.
    • Install a New Motor Coupling: If the motor coupling that connects the motor to the drum is broken, it will need to be replaced.
    • Fix or Replace the Clutch Assembly: A worn-out clutch can stop the drum from spinning at the proper speed and requires replacement.
    • Fix Loose or Broken Suspension Springs: Damaged springs can lead to unbalanced loads, preventing the washer from spinning properly.
